2011-03-11 74 views
7

在配置我的第一次Hadoop的NameNode的,我知道我需要運行如何判斷hadoop namenode是否已被格式化?

bin/hadoop namenode -format 

但運行這個第二次,將數據加載到HDFS後,將消滅一切並重新格式化。有沒有簡單的方法來判斷一個namenode是否已被格式化?

回答

4

那麼你可以檢查這個文件 商店1 /名/電流/ VERSION

如果存在,那麼它已經被格式化。 PS:你在生產系統中的格式只有一次格式化。在安裝過程中或在緊急恢復時間內手動更好。

+1

Thejaswi,謝謝你 - 我正在開發一個配置腳本,它負責處理所有事情,並且希望能夠多次運行配置而不用搞砸HDFS。配置提升三個新的配置文件,並確保所有設置都正確。當我進行格式化調用時,我最終只是迴應'N',因爲這告訴節點不要重新格式化HDFS。 – 2011-03-25 17:39:45

相關問題